Tengrinews.kz – The press service of Kairat FC has revealed how many Real Madrid fans are expected to attend the upcoming Champions League match in Almaty.
Spain’s ambassador, Luis Francisco Martinez Montes, visited Kairat’s facilities, and during the meeting, the club shared details about the number of international fans attending the match.
“As part of the meeting, details of the upcoming match with Madrid’s Real were discussed. Over 1,000 Spanish fans are expected to travel to Almaty, covering more than 6,500 kilometers to support their team. The Spanish Embassy expressed readiness to provide consular assistance to the visitors,” the club’s statement said.
The Kairat vs. Real Madrid match in the UEFA Champions League is scheduled for September 30 at Central Stadium in Almaty, which has a capacity of 23,804 spectators.

Ticket sales: what’s known
So far, tickets for the Kairat vs. Real Madrid match have not yet gone on sale.
Serik Zharasbayev, Vice Minister of Tourism and Sports, stated that ticket sales will begin in the third week of September, about 10 days before kickoff. He also mentioned that a portion of the tickets will be distributed for free.
Meanwhile, Almaty police have issued a warning about fraudsters attempting to sell fake or non-existent tickets for the match.

Earlier, Kairat fans launched a petition asking to limit ticket sales for the game against Madrid's Real to avoid scalping and ensure that more local fans can attend.
